
The Role of GPS in Disaster Management and Humanitarian Aid π¨π
GPS technology is critical in disaster response, helping emergency teams save lives and coordinate aid effectively.
1. GPS for Early Warning Systems
βοΈ GPS-based monitoring helps track earthquakes, hurricanes, and tsunamis.
βοΈ Provides real-time location data to issue timely alerts and evacuations.
βοΈ Assists in forecasting disasters by analyzing environmental changes.
2. Enhancing Search and Rescue Operations
βοΈ GPS allows responders to locate survivors in collapsed buildings, forests, and flooded areas.
βοΈ Helps in coordinating rescue teams efficiently using real-time mapping.
βοΈ Drones with GPS assist in aerial searches and delivering aid.
3. GPS for Humanitarian Aid Distribution
βοΈ Organizations use GPS to track aid shipments and ensure they reach affected communities.
βοΈ Helps in setting up temporary shelters and medical camps in the right locations.
βοΈ Reduces wastage and ensures efficient use of resources.
4. Post-Disaster Recovery with GPS Mapping
βοΈ Governments use GPS to assess damage and plan rebuilding efforts.
βοΈ Helps restore infrastructure like roads, power grids, and water systems.
βοΈ Enables long-term disaster preparedness strategies.
With GPS, disaster management teams can act faster, reduce casualties, and provide better aid to those in need.
